    Re: 500 hr club ball

    OK
    1. Ted WIlliams and Mantle on sweet spot does NOT make it 'bad'. In fact the majority of Score Board balls had those on the sweet spot. Unfortunately, so it was the favorite of the forgers

    2. every, and I mean EVERY signature on that ball is off. all 12 are not authentically signed by the player in question. It is not just a forgery, it is a poorly executed one
